Definition and Scope:

Mesoporous molecular sieve catalytic materials are a type of porous material with uniform pore sizes ranging from 2 to 50 nm. These materials are widely used in catalysis due to their high surface area, tunable pore size, and ordered pore structure, which allow for efficient mass transfer and catalytic reactions. Mesoporous molecular sieves are commonly employed in various industries such as petrochemicals, pharmaceuticals, and environmental remediation, where they serve as catalysts for chemical reactions, adsorbents for separating molecules, and supports for immobilizing active species. The unique properties of these materials make them versatile and highly sought after in the market.
